White Forest in Editorial Layouts and Content Hierarchy

When integrating White Forest into an editorial layout, the font excels at establishing clear visual hierarchy. Its bold weight and distinctive shape make it stand out as a headline, drawing readers’ eyes to key sections of a story or feature. For a recipe ebook, for instance, using White Forest for chapter openers gives each section a fresh, engaging start that complements the content’s structure.

However, it’s important to consider where White Forest fits best. While it’s excellent for titles, subtitles, and pull quotes, it may not be the best choice for body text or long-form content. The font’s expressive nature can become distracting if overused, especially in dense paragraphs or small print. For such cases, pairing it with a readable serif or sans serif font ensures balance and clarity.

Readability is a key concern when using White Forest in different mediums. On mobile screens, the font maintains its legibility, but it’s advisable to avoid using it in very small sizes or low-contrast backgrounds. For PDF exports, ensure that the font is embedded properly to prevent rendering issues. In print materials, White Forest’s boldness can enhance the overall design, making it a go-to choice for logos, posters, and promotional graphics.

Before incorporating White Forest into any project, it’s essential to check the font’s available styles, alternates, and ligatures. These features can enhance the design by allowing for more creative expression while maintaining typographic integrity. Additionally, verifying multilingual support and commercial licensing is crucial for those using the font in paid newsletters, templates, or client publications.
